Output f6a368c613a2885879fe2784718c2fe075d7f938ed7badc124771ad388afbc41:5

value
21108880
script pubkey
OP_0 OP_PUSHBYTES_20 8968579af5a31eb9ab30cab035493cb0188234dd
address
ltc1q39590xh45v0tn2ese2cr2jfukqvgydxachf034
transaction
f6a368c613a2885879fe2784718c2fe075d7f938ed7badc124771ad388afbc41
spent
true